2009VOFinalAudience_small.jpgThe 7th Columbia 300 Vienna Open is the 11th stop of the 2009 European Bowling Tour and one of the Tour's "Majors". The tournament is being held from Tuesday Sept. 29 through Sunday Oct. 4, 2009 at the renovated 32-lane Plus Bowling in Vienna, Austria. More than 340 players will compete for an increased total prize money of 68.130 Euro - 65.630 Euro - 55.400 € in Singles and 10.230 € in Doubles. The singles champion receives the 6.000 Euro top prize while the doubles winners split 1.600.
